Senior Operations Manager jobs represent a critical leadership tier within organizations, responsible for the strategic oversight and execution of core business functions that drive efficiency, quality, and growth. Professionals in these roles are the architects of operational excellence, translating high-level business objectives into actionable plans and measurable results. They serve as the vital link between executive strategy and frontline execution, ensuring that every process, team, and resource is aligned to achieve organizational goals. For those seeking to impact an organization's foundational performance, Senior Operations Manager positions offer a challenging and rewarding career path at the heart of business success. The typical remit of a Senior Operations Manager is broad and multifaceted. Core responsibilities generally encompass the end-to-end management of operational workflows, including process design, optimization, and continuous improvement initiatives. They are accountable for key performance indicators (KPIs) such as productivity, cost management, quality assurance, and service delivery. A significant part of the role involves leading and developing large or multiple teams, fostering a high-performance culture, and mentoring future leaders. Furthermore, Senior Operations Managers are tasked with ensuring strict compliance with industry regulations and internal policies, managing risk, and upholding safety standards. They act as senior escalation points during major incidents or disruptions, leading crisis management and recovery efforts with decisive action. Strategic planning is also a cornerstone, as they contribute to budgeting, resource allocation, technology implementation, and long-term operational scaling strategies. To excel in Senior Operations Manager jobs, candidates typically need a robust blend of leadership, analytical, and strategic skills. A proven track record of 7-10 years in progressive operations management is commonly required, often within a specific industry like manufacturing, logistics, financial services, or technology. Essential competencies include superior people management and the ability to inspire cross-functional teams. Expertise in process improvement methodologies such as Lean or Six Sigma is highly valued, as is financial acumen for P&L oversight. These professionals must possess exceptional problem-solving abilities and the capacity to make data-driven decisions under pressure. Strong communication and stakeholder management skills are non-negotiable, enabling them to influence at all organizational levels and articulate complex operational concepts clearly. A bachelor's degree in business administration, engineering, or a related field is standard, with many employers preferring an MBA or advanced degree. Ultimately, Senior Operations Manager jobs are designed for strategic leaders who thrive on optimizing complex systems and driving tangible business outcomes. They are pivotal in building resilient, efficient, and scalable operations that provide a competitive advantage.
